Newcastle is a fucking mess, and not all of that is self inflicted. Paul Mitchell should never have a top flight job again as far as many are concerned, including neutrals outside of Newcastle.

The Isak deal should have been done in June based on everything that has been coming out over the last few weeks. Isak and his agent, in their minds, were led to believe they'd be able to move on at this time going back a year ago. Newcastle could have collected the money at the start of the summer and reinvested it into their squad. Instead, they have been without leadership and now it's coming down to the wire. I'm not sure how you go back from your supporters chanting "One Greedy bastard" about a player and then consider trying to "reintegrate" said player back into the squad.

If Isak ends up staying at Newcastle, he and his agent should have something worked out immediately on September 1st so that he is gone by January 1st. None of this is super complicated

Balogun and Pepi are your number 9's. As long as Balogun is healthy and plays like he did the last two games, he should be the starter.
3-4-3 formation worked well. Left some defensive holes, but it certainly provided a dynamic attack.
Will be interesting to see who they put as the attacking mf on the wings. Freeman, Arfsten and Dest could really thrive there. Do you put Robinson in the midfield winger spot or does he play in a defesnive role in the 3-4-3. I wonder how Cardoso fits in. Luna would be a perfect sub in the midfield.
Still have a lot to figure out with midfeild and defense. Is it McKennie and Adams who start centrally? Who do you have besides Richards? Ream looks too old but apparently no one else can play quality defense.
Freese should be the starter from here on out.
